Definition of Drug Supply: Which actions constitute supply?

Explanation:
In UK drug law, “supply” is understood broadly to cover any act that transfers a controlled drug to another person, or makes such a transfer possible, including the steps that enable it. So transferring to someone else is supply because you’re handing the drug over. Offering to supply is also an offence on its own, even if the transfer never happens, because you’ve shown the intention and readiness to provide the drug. Being concerned in the supply means you’re involved in the process of getting the drug to another person—such as organizing, financing, transporting, or arranging it—even if you don’t physically hand it over yourself. Taken together, these elements show that the law targets not just the final act of handing over a drug, but the entire chain of activity that brings it to someone else. Hence, all of these actions amount to supply.
